Transaction 110468ffeb4ab1610491bc26d8fdaea48691e952dfe7b8797aaa39e502dc8ce5
1 Input
2 Outputs
- 110468ffeb4ab1610491bc26d8fdaea48691e952dfe7b8797aaa39e502dc8ce5:0
- 110468ffeb4ab1610491bc26d8fdaea48691e952dfe7b8797aaa39e502dc8ce5:1
value 750000
address 3Dzoturn4CdfkasXfhgYXUwjd7Hr7mvp7s
value 1447402957
address 15hVKsLhkwnxbmS4PXPfcAPrURcbHP8qEZ